Output e8099456a9c601f71d4940db39b9e0aebf8f05d19a4a7c9166666d04e433e2a0:7

value
9600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 39ef9e649fc245032fef7b98d76f0c20c9cdb572 OP_EQUAL
address
MDBVoN91NxFGyNLAhtb4rHQp5YhdK3V9ox
transaction
e8099456a9c601f71d4940db39b9e0aebf8f05d19a4a7c9166666d04e433e2a0
spent
true